Bob Eubanks Obituary

Bob Roy Eubanks, 84 of Benton, passed away on March 16, 2021.  He was born on February 3, 1937, in Dardanelle, to the late Charley Odell and Eunice Gossage Eubanks.  Bob was a veteran of the United States Air Force and retired from Alcoa.  He was a member of the New Song Church of God. Bob was a man who loved his family.  His love was quiet but profound.  He was a generous man who could not but help others he saw were in need, even if it meant he would do without.  Bob never expected anything in return.  His legacy is one filled with children and grandchildren who love the Lord and love others.  Bob will be greatly missed, but his strength, values and love will live on. Bob was preceded in death by his parents; brother, Jack Lee Eubanks; and sister, Carrie Wilcoxen. Bob is survived by his wife of 61 years, Doris Ann Eubanks; sons, Robert Eubanks, Kevin (Cynthia) Eubanks and Todd Eubanks; daughter, Jeannie (Bob) Burchfield; brother, Seburn Eubanks; sister, Charlene McAllister; grandchildren, James Burchfield, Ann Marie Burchfield Mahan, Kaitlyn Paige Eubanks, Chelsea Eubanks Abbott, Elizabeth Eubanks Dickard and Caroline Eubanks.
